Types of False Ceiling Designs

Choosing the right false ceiling design depends on your style preference, budget, and functionality needs. Here are the most popular types of false ceilings:

  1. Gypsum False Ceiling – Lightweight, durable, and easy to install.
  2. POP (Plaster of Paris) False Ceiling – Offers intricate designs and smooth finishes.
  3. Wooden False Ceiling – Adds warmth and luxury to interiors.
  4. Metal False Ceiling – Ideal for industrial or commercial spaces.
  5. Glass False Ceiling – Provides a modern and stylish touch.
  6. PVC False Ceiling – Affordable and low-maintenance option.
  7. Fabric or Synthetic False Ceiling – Used for decorative and event-based settings.

Each false ceiling design comes with unique features that enhance the look and functionality of your space.

Benefits of False Ceiling Design

Opting for a false ceiling design offers multiple advantages beyond just aesthetics. Some key benefits include:

  • Enhanced Aesthetics: A well-designed false ceiling enhances the beauty of a room.
  • Better Lighting Options: Concealed lighting, LED strips, and cove lighting can be integrated.
  • Improved Acoustics: Reduces noise and echoes, making it ideal for auditoriums and offices.
  • Thermal Insulation: Helps in regulating room temperature and reduces energy costs.
  • Hiding Electrical Wiring: Keeps wires and cables concealed for a neat look.
  • Moisture and Fire Resistance: Certain materials provide added safety features.

Considering these benefits, it is no surprise that false ceiling design is a preferred choice for modern interiors.

False Ceiling Design for Kitchen and Bathroom

Kitchens and bathrooms also benefit from false ceiling designs, improving both aesthetics and functionality. Here are some practical options:

  • PVC False Ceiling: Moisture-resistant and easy to clean.
  • Gypsum Ceiling with LED Panels: Provides bright illumination.
  • Metal Ceiling Panels: Ideal for industrial-style kitchens.
  • POP False Ceiling with Ventilation Cutouts: Ensures proper airflow.
  • Acrylic or Glass Ceilings: Enhances natural lighting and style.

The right false ceiling design makes these functional spaces look more stylish while ensuring durability.

Cost and Maintenance of False Ceiling Design

Before finalizing a false ceiling design, it is essential to consider the cost and maintenance aspects.

  • Material Cost: Gypsum and POP are budget-friendly, while wood and metal are more expensive.
  • Installation Charges: Skilled labor is required for proper installation.
  • Maintenance Needs: PVC and metal ceilings require less upkeep compared to POP and wood.
  • Longevity: A well-maintained false ceiling design can last for decades.

Balancing cost and maintenance ensures that your false ceiling design remains stylish and durable for years.

FAQs

1. What is the best material for a false ceiling design?

Gypsum and POP are the most commonly used materials due to their affordability, durability, and ease of installation.

2. How long does a false ceiling design last?

A well-maintained false ceiling design can last 10-25 years, depending on the material and environmental conditions.

3. Can a false ceiling reduce noise?

Yes, certain false ceiling designs, such as acoustic panels and gypsum boards, help reduce noise levels in a room.

4. Is a false ceiling good for small rooms?

Yes, a false ceiling design can enhance small spaces with the right lighting and patterns to create an illusion of height.

5. How much does a false ceiling design cost?

The cost varies based on material, design complexity, and labor charges, typically ranging from $3 to $10 per square foot.
